riding hats and boots

hi all

i have recently taken up horse riding again and have been borrowing hats from the centre but now has come the time to buy my own as its definetly not a phase (!) - does anyone know somewhere good but cheap to buy things like boots and hats from ?? i only ride once a week so dont want to spend loads but want something good too....

Best to get your hat expertly fitted though! Having had a horse kick my head I was very glad of my well fitting hat!

Totally agree a hat must be new and fitted,never buy second hand hats you never know if they have been dropped.

Only problem with buying online is you cant get your hat or boots fitted. Boots arent so bad but personally i like to makesure they are comfy and fit properly. The hat must be fitted by a professional
